      Album Details

      Immerse yourself in the timeless elegance of Frédéric Chopin's compositions with Vladimir Ashkenazy's masterful interpretation in "Ashkenazy plays Chopin: Vol. I - Etudes & More." Released on December 12, 2024, this album is a testament to Ashkenazy's enduring legacy as one of the most revered pianists of our time. Spanning a generous 1 hour and 59 minutes, this collection is a comprehensive journey through some of Chopin's most celebrated and technically demanding works.

      The album features a meticulously curated selection of Chopin's etudes, waltzes, mazurkas, and other solo piano pieces. Ashkenazy's renditions are not just performances; they are profound explorations of Chopin's intricate compositions, showcasing the pianist's unparalleled technical prowess and deep emotional resonance. Each piece, from the virtuosic "Revolutionary" Etude to the delicate "Minute Waltz," is rendered with a clarity and precision that highlights Chopin's genius and Ashkenazy's mastery.

      This album is a must-listen for both seasoned classical music enthusiasts and those new to the genre. Ashkenazy's interpretations bring a fresh perspective to these beloved works, making them accessible and engaging for all listeners. Whether you are drawn to the technical brilliance of the etudes or the lyrical beauty of the waltzes and mazurkas, this album offers a rich and rewarding listening experience.

      Vladimir Ashkenazy's 1959/60 recordings of Chopin's etudes are often regarded as some of the finest interpretations ever recorded. This album captures the essence of those historic performances while also reflecting the pianist's continued evolution and refinement over the years. The result is a collection that is both timeless and contemporary, a true celebration of Chopin's enduring legacy and Ashkenazy's artistic brilliance.

      About Frédéric Chopin

      Frédéric Chopin, born in 1810 near Warsaw to a French father and Polish mother, was a virtuoso pianist and composer who left an indelible mark on the Romantic era. Renowned for his poetic genius and unparalleled technical prowess, Chopin's compositions, primarily for solo piano, continue to captivate audiences worldwide. His repertoire, including iconic pieces like the Preludes, Nocturnes, and Waltzes, showcases his emotional depth and innovative musical style. Chopin's life, though brief, was marked by his extraordinary talent, which he began displaying at the tender age of seven. His debut in Vienna at just 19 years old set the stage for a career that would solidify his status as one of the greatest composers of his time. Chopin's music, characterized by its expressive melodies and intricate harmonies, remains a cornerstone of classical piano repertoire, inspiring generations of musicians and enthusiasts alike.
